低温胁迫下不同磷营养对水稻叶片质膜透性及抗氧化酶活性的影响
Effects of Different Phosphate Fertilizer Application on Permeability of Membrane and Antioxidative Enzymes in Rice under Low Temperature Stress
摘要
Abstract
A pot experiment was conducted to investigate the effects of different level of phosphate fertilizer application on permeability of membrane and antioxidative enzymes in rice( non-chilling cv. Changbai 9 and chilling-tolerant cv. Jijing 81 ) under low temperature stress. The results showed that as the increasing of P fertilizer applica-tion,membrane permeability and MDA decreased and the increased in P-treated rice,but soluble sugar content,pro-line, peroxidase( POD) ,catalase( CAT) and superoxide dismutase ( SOD) increased and then decreased. Compared with the normal temperature treatment, appropriately increasing phosphorus can improve the content of soluble sugar, praline, add the activity of POD,CAT,SOD,and decline membrane permeability and MDA content in rice under low temperture stress. The increase rates of the soluble sugar,proline, POD,CAT,SOD for P treatment in non-chilling cv. Changbai 9 were higher than those in chilling-tolerant cv. Jijing 81 under low temperature stress, and membrane permeability and MDA content decreased even more. The results indicated that membrane permeability and antioxidative enzymes of rice can be improved by exogenous application of phosphorus, it is beneficial to increase the cold resistance of rice.关键词
